AvalonBay Communities (NYSE:AVB) Given New $251.00 Price Target at Scotiabank

AvalonBay Communities logo with Finance background

AvalonBay Communities (NYSE:AVB - Free Report) had its price target upped by Scotiabank from $241.00 to $251.00 in a report issued on Monday,Benzinga reports. Scotiabank currently has a sector perform rating on the real estate investment trust's stock.

AvalonBay Communities Stock Down 1.6%

Shares of AVB traded down $3.25 during mid-day trading on Monday, reaching $201.45. The company's stock had a trading volume of 858,391 shares, compared to its average volume of 702,373.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.68, a current ratio of 1.64 and a quick ratio of 1.64. AvalonBay Communities has a 12-month low of $180.40 and a 12-month high of $239.29. The stock has a market cap of $28.68 billion, a PE ratio of 26.54,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 3.11 and a beta of 0.86. The company's 50 day moving average is $206.05 and its 200 day moving average is $217.09.

AvalonBay Communities (NYSE:AVB -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 30th. The real estate investment trust reported $2.83 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$2.80 by $0.03. The company had revenue of $693.43 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$744.61 million. AvalonBay Communities had a net margin of 37.13% and a return on equity of 9.15%.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$2.70 earnings per share. Equities analysts anticipate that AvalonBay Communities will post 11.48 EPS for the current fiscal year.

AvalonBay Communities Company Profile

AvalonBay Communities, Inc is a real estate investment trust, which engages in the development, acquisition, ownership, and operation of multifamily communities. It operates through the following segments: Same Store, Other Stabilized, and Development or Redevelopment. The Same Store segment refers to the operating communities that were owned and had stabilized occupancy.
